Natchaug Hospital is Eastern Connecticut's leading provider for
children, adolescents and adults with mental illness and substance
abuse addictions. We offers a variety of programs including
inpatient and outpatient behavioral health, residential treatment
for court-involved teenage girls, geriatric services, clinical day
treatment schools and chemical dependency services. Through our
multi-site network of care, we constantly strive to meet its
mission in helping people find their way while educating and
empowering individuals to participate in their own care and
recovery.
Job Summary
The Registered Nurse utilizes psychiatric/chemical dependency
nursing skills as a direct client care provider and is an integral
member of the multidisciplinary team. The RN works under the
direction of the Nurse Manager and/or the RN Designee and is
responsible for the delivery of direct client care to clients
individually, in groups and in the milieu. The RN is a role model
for other staff members and is a leader in teaching other staff, in
program development, in guiding group decision making, in
developing and implementing treatment plans and improving the
quality of care. The RN adheres to Hospital policies and procedures
as well as applicable accreditation standards and state and federal
regulations towards excellence in client care. Registered Nurses
